Exhaust gas purifying catalyst system
Abstract
Disclosed is an exhaust gas purifying catalyst system, which comprises an upstream catalyst disposed in an exhaust gas passage of an engine at a position on an upstream side with respect to a direction of an exhaust gas stream, and a downstream catalyst disposed in the exhaust gas passage at a position on a downstream side with respect to the direction of the exhaust gas stream. In the exhaust gas purifying catalyst system, the downstream catalyst includes a cerium (Ce)-containing rhodium-doped composite oxide and an Ni component, and the upstream catalyst includes a cerium (Ce)-containing composite oxide other than the rhodium-doped composite oxide, and a Ni component. A ratio of Ni to CeO 2 in the upstream catalyst is in the range of 15 to 20 mass %, and a ratio of Ni to CeO 2 in the downstream catalyst is in the range of 10 to 60 mass %. The exhaust gas purifying catalyst system of the present invention can reduce an amount of H 2 S emission while achieving high purification performance.

An exhaust gas purifying catalyst system comprising an upstream catalyst disposed in an exhaust gas passage of an engine at a position on an upstream side with respect to a direction of an exhaust gas stream, and a downstream catalyst disposed in said exhaust gas passage at a position on a downstream side with respect to the direction of said exhaust gas stream, wherein:
said downstream catalyst includes a cerium (Ce)-containing oxygen storage material consisting of a rhodium-doped composite oxide having rhodium arranged at a lattice position or interlattice position of a crystal structure thereof, and at least either one of nickel (Ni) and nickel oxide (NiO); and said upstream catalyst includes a cerium (Ce)-containing oxygen storage material consisting of a composite oxide other than said rhodium-doped composite oxide, and at least either one of nickel (Ni) and nickel oxide (NiO), wherein a ratio of Ni to CeO 2 in said upstream catalyst is in the range of 15 to 20 mass %, and a ratio of Ni to CeO 2 in said downstream catalyst is in the range of 10 to 60 mass %.
2 . The exhaust gas purifying catalyst system as defined in claim 1 , wherein each of said respective composite oxides included in said upstream catalyst and said downstream catalyst includes zirconium and neodymium.
3 . The exhaust gas purifying catalyst system as defined in claim 1 , wherein the ratio of Ni to CeO 2 in said upstream catalyst is greater than the ratio of Ni to CeO 2 in said downstream catalyst.
4 . The exhaust gas purifying catalyst system as defined in claim 1 , wherein each of said respective composite oxides included in said upstream catalyst and said downstream catalyst supports a catalytic noble metal thereon.
5 . The exhaust gas purifying catalyst system as defined in claim 4 , wherein:
